独孤客户管理系统 进销存ERP管理系统   独孤CRM登陆   留言建议
管理软件知识 在线试用免费注册  

设计一个图书管理系统数据库

独孤软件体验账号和密码
体验帐号 demo
密码 123
体验网址 https://dugusoft.com/erp/
扫码体验独孤ERP管理系统

随着数字化时代的到来,图书管理系统已经成为了图书馆必不可少的一部分。图书管理系统数据库是图书管理系统的核心,它可以帮助图书馆管理人员更好地管理图书馆的藏书,提高图书馆的服务质量。本文将介绍如何设计一个图书管理系统数据库。


一、需求分析

在设计图书管理系统数据库之前,我们需要先进行需求分析。根据图书馆的实际需求,我们需要设计一个能够满足以下功能的数据库:

图书信息管理:包括图书的基本信息、借阅信息、归还信息等。

读者信息管理:包括读者的基本信息、借阅信息、归还信息等。

借阅管理:包括借阅记录、借阅时间、归还时间等。

预约管理:包括预约记录、预约时间、预约状态等。

统计分析:包括图书借阅量、读者借阅量、图书流通率等。

二、数据库设计

在进行数据库设计之前,我们需要先确定数据库的结构。根据需求分析,我们可以将数据库分为以下几个表:

图书信息表:包括图书编号、图书名称、作者、出版社、出版日期、价格、分类号等字段。

读者信息表:包括读者编号、读者姓名、性别、年龄、联系方式等字段。

借阅信息表:包括借阅编号、图书编号、读者编号、借阅时间、归还时间等字段。

预约信息表:包括预约编号、图书编号、读者编号、预约时间、预约状态等字段。

统计分析表:包括图书借阅量、读者借阅量、图书流通率等字段。


三、数据库实现

在确定数据库结构之后,我们需要进行数据库实现。我们可以使用MySQL数据库进行实现。具体实现步骤如下:

创建数据库:我们可以使用MySQL Workbench创建一个名为“library”的数据库。

创建表:根据数据库结构,我们可以使用SQL语句创建相应的表。

插入数据:我们可以使用SQL语句向表中插入数据。

查询数据:我们可以使用SQL语句查询表中的数据。


四、数据库优化

在实现数据库之后,我们需要对数据库进行优化,以提高数据库的性能。具体优化方法如下:

索引优化:我们可以为表中的字段创建索引,以提高查询速度。

数据库分区:我们可以将数据库分为多个分区,以提高查询速度。

数据库缓存:我们可以使用缓存技术,将常用的数据缓存到内存中,以提高查询速度。


五、总结

设计一个图书管理系统数据库需要进行需求分析、数据库设计、数据库实现和数据库优化等步骤。通过合理的数据库设计和优化,可以提高图书管理系统的性能,提高图书馆的服务质量。

点击右边的链接下载pdf文件:设计一个图书管理系统数据库.pdf



文章推荐:

计划管理软件 仓库进销存管理软件免费版 工程建设项目审批管理系统
erp管理系统哪家好 合同管理系统软件 电销crm管理系统
免费项目管理软件 小企业进销存管理软件 图纸管理系统
客户关系crm管理系统 erp在线管理系统试用 备件管理系统
仓库库存管理系统 服务管理系统 企业管理系统有哪些软件
mom管理系统 etc门店管理系统 资料管理软件
房地产系统管理软件有哪些 gs企业管理软件 订单管理系统开源
人力资源信息管理系统 商城后台管理系统 工厂生产管理系统
全面预算管理系统 汽修管理软件 mes生产管理系统
erp生产订单管理系统 rfid管理系统 工资管理系统

进销存管理系统 进销存软件 ERP管理系统 ERP管理软件
销售管理系统 销售管理软件 客户管理系统 好爱记单词

CopyRight:深圳市独孤软件技术有限公司  咨询电话:0755-84820804  电子邮件:dugusoft@foxmail.com  隐私政策  关于Cookies  免责声明
工信部备案:粤ICP备12074630号    粤公网安备:44030702001974号